\n" ); document.write( ": The gym is 21 years newer than the auditorium. the gym is also one fourth as old as the auditorium. How old is each building?\r

Age of the Auditorium = unknown = n
\n" ); document.write( "Age of the Gym = n-21 [The gym is 21 years newer than the auditorium]
\n" ); document.write( "Age of the Gym = (1/4)n [the gym is also one fourth as old as the auditorium]
\n" ); document.write( "Gym = Gym
\n" ); document.write( "So, n-21=(1/4)n
\n" ); document.write( "n-n-21=(1/4)n-n [Isolate all of the terms to one side of the equation]
\n" ); document.write( "21=(3/4)n
\n" ); document.write( "0=(3/4)n-21 [Equation of the problem]
\n" ); document.write( ".\r
\n" ); document.write( "\n" ); document.write( "(3/4)n -21=0 [solve for \"n\"]
\n" ); document.write( "(3/4)n-21+21=0+21
\n" ); document.write( "(3/4)n=21
\n" ); document.write( "(4/3)(3/4)n=(21)(4/3)
\n" ); document.write( "n=28= the age of the auditorium
\n" ); document.write( ".
\n" ); document.write( "Check by plugging (n=28) back into the original equations
\n" ); document.write( "Age of the Gym = n-21 = 28-21=7
\n" ); document.write( "Age of the Gym = (1/4)n = (1/4)(28/1)=7
\n" ); document.write( "[checks out]
